Betty White to receive Lifetime Achievement award at next month’s Daytime Emmys

http://images.buddytv.com/articles/gossip-girl-betty-white.jpgIf you thought there were no more awards to give Betty White, you are wrong.

It’s just been announced that the television legend will receive the Lifetime Achievement Award at next month’s Daytime Emmys.

I love this because it makes so much sense. Betty was a game show regular for decades – especially on Password which was hosted by her late husband, Allen Ludden. She was also on Match Game countless times and won an Emmy for hosting the game show Just Men. She was also nominated for an Emmy for her performance in the daytime soap The Bold and the Beautiful.

“Betty is a woman who has excelled in everything she has ever done,” says the National Academy of Television Arts and Sciences Senior Vice President of Daytime David Michaels.  “She is also one of the nicest women in show business and we are proud to be bestowing this honor on such an exemplary role model for our entire industry.”

Ms. White will be joining an illustrious group of previous Lifetime Achievement Honorees including, Oprah Winfrey, Barbara Walters, Merv Griffin, Dick Clark, Bob Barker, Phil Donahue, Regis Philbin, Alex Trebek and many others.
